Compare all specifications:
1987 Audi 200 | 1981 Fiat Ritmo | |
Make | Audi | Fiat |
Model | 200 | Ritmo |
Year Released | 1987 | 1981 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 2144 cc | 1498 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 5 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 180 HP | 81 HP |
Torque | 252 Nm | 127 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3600 RPM | 3000 RPM |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 4 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 2 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1480 kg | 920 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4800 mm | 4040 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1820 mm | 1660 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1430 mm | 1420 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2700 mm | 2460 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 58 L | 57 L |
